Versatile New Options
Conexant's latest DSS device set supports CID applications via frequency
shift keying (FSK) detection and CAS tone detection hardware and software.
It also enables central office messaging via stutter dial tone (SDT) detection
and visual message waiting indication (VMWI). Integrated Telephone
Answering Devices (ITAD) are supported via real-time clock and seven-
segment drivers. Two-line applications can be supported via a second codec
and three independent dual-tone multifrequency (DTMF) generators. The new
API firmware architecture provides increased flexibility and simplifies code-
development programming.
Conexant's DSS family enables phone designers to lower system costs
and find the best match for their architectural needs by offering five unique
mixed- signal baseband device options:
Standard basic device
Custom mask programmed device
Custom mask programmed device with CID
External memory (XROM) device
External memory (XROM) device with CID

Baseband Devices
Basic
The Basic baseband device is a 100-pin MonopacTM device that
offers the most cost-effective telephone design. It contains all the
necessary firmware to provide standard functionality, including
dual keypad and speakerphone features. It also offers Conexant's
patented "OEM Parameters" option that enables OEMs to
customize the product by setting bit fields in an external serial
EEPROM device.
Custom
The Custom baseband device is a 100-pin Monopac device that
offers 48 KB of ROM and 2 KB of RAM to let OEMs write custom
firmware for higher-end models. To help lower costs, the device is
available with or without integrated CID support.
External Memory (XROM)
The XROM baseband device is a 128-pin stand-alone device
which can access up to 59 KB of external ROM. It aids firmware
development by providing access to ROM emulator control
signals. OEMs can use this device to achieve a fast time to
market for feature-rich phones. OEMs also can store the firmware
in an external memory device. Like the custom baseband device,
the XROM is available with or without integrated CID support.
Flash Emulation Development Device
The Flash emulation development device is a pin-compatible
development tool with the same package dimensions as the
Basic or Custom baseband device. It allows programmers to
evaluate and debug their code on their own production platform
prior to masking a ROM device, reducing the time to market and
improving the quality of the finished product.
RF Devices
Spread Spectrum Transceivers
The RF105 (for 900 MHz operation) and RF109 (for 2.4 GHz
operation) are fully integrated transceiver ICs that provide
complete transmit, receive and frequency synthesis functions.
They use a direct-conversion architecture and time division
duplexing (TDD) of the transmit and receive signals to minimize
circuit complexity.
Spread Spectrum Power Amplifiers
The RF106 (for 900 MHz operation) and RF110 (for 2.4 GHz
operation) are class-AB power amplifiers (PA), designed for ISM
band applications. They deliver output power proportional to the
input signal from the RF105 or RF109 transceiver IC, up to a
maximum of 100 mW.
Application Programming Interface (API)
Conexant's DSS offerings provide a convenient software
development environment through an Application Programming
Interface (API). The API enables developers to focus on application
layer software by taking care of lower-level functions such as link
establishment and management as well as audio processing.
The API accelerates software development activities to support
fast time-to-market designs.

Features
Baseband Device Set
General
Direct sequence Digital Spread Spectrum telephone system
Integrated CID, TAD, and message services support
Single system solution for base station and handset
Telephone firmware provided
3V, low-power operation
>14-day standby
>4-hour talk time
OEM Parameters for easy customization
System Controller
MC19 CPU (65C02-based)
Single 19.2 MHz system clock with low-power,
on-chip oscillator
On-chip 48K ROM, 2K RAM
Watchdog/sleep/wake-up timer
External parallel bus (128-pin XROM only)
Emulation port through parallel bus (128-pin XROM only)
Controller Peripheral Functions
900 MHz or 2.4 GHz RF transceiver control
Multiplexed 6x8 keypad/GPIO switches/LCD data interface
Battery-level detector with thresholds
Serial port for I2CTM or 4-wire MicrowireTM serial EEPROM
4- or 8-bit parallel LCD data interface port
6 masked LED control ports with programmable on/off durations
Lighted keypad control
Selectable flash duration
Selectable DTMF intervals
Real-time clock
Seven-segment display driver
Support for two audio codecs
DSS Baseband Modem
I/Q A/D modem input
DBPSK DSS modulator/demodulator
12-chips/bit, 11 dB processing gain
Additional security with >224 ID and control channel scrambling codes
Automatic frequency control (AFC)
Automatic gain control (AGC)
40 independent RF channels for 2.4 GHz/20 for 900 MHz
(902928 or 24002483.5 MHz band)
Audio Co-Processor
19.2 MHz 16-bit processor
ADPCM Vocoder (ITU G.726 compliant)
Audio path and gain controls
Stutter dial tone detection
FSK detection
CAS detection
Audio Codec
Full-ITU G.714 compliant standard voice frequency linear
encoder/decoder
Delta-Sigma ADC/DAC with dynamic range >70 dB
8 KHz sampling rate
Line input and output (600-ohm load) for PSTN interfaces
DSS Firmware
Simple API code structure for link control and audio path/gain setting
Embedded RF transceiver control software
Audio and PSTN interfaces
User-customizable phone control software
Test mode
Programmable audio gain table
Driver for LCD with CID message display
Two-line support
Packages
Single-device ASIC/codec: 100-pin PQFP
XROM ASIC: 128-pin TQFP
Audio Codec: 32-pin TQFP
Direct-Conversion Transceiver
General
900 MHz or 2.4 GHz solutions available
Direct-conversion differential BPSK (DBPSK) transmit modulator
High-, medium- and low-power transmitter output levels
Direct-conversion receiver with I/Q baseband outputs
Receiver AGC
Large dynamic range: 90 dB
Single-supply voltage: 3.0V to 5.0V
RF105/RF109 Transceivers
Single-chip RF transceiver
Low power dissipation
Fast settling from standby mode
64 programmable channels with 600 KHz or 1.8 KHz
channel spacing
3-battery-cell operation
RF106/RF110 Power Amplifiers
RF power amplifier with 100 mW peak envelope output power
High efficiency from class-AB action
Packages
RF105/RF109: 48-pin ETQFP package
RF106/RF110: 20-pin TSSOP package
